The brake fluid reservoir on a 1996 Ford Ranger is typically located
under the hood, near the master cylinder. The master cylinder is the main component of the braking system, and the reservoir is usually a small, clear or translucent container attached to it. It often has markings indicating the minimum and maximum fluid levels. Look for a cap with a brake fluid symbol (often a circle with a diagonal line through it).
However, it's crucial to consult your 1996 Ford Ranger's owner's manual. The exact location might vary slightly depending on the trim level and specific model of your truck. The owner's manual will have a diagram showing the location and provide important safety information regarding brake fluid handling.
